我想知道当我将SSH连接到服务器时,是否有办法让MacVim成为我的默认编辑器。有没有办法让服务器的.vimrc文件在我的Mac上启动程序?
我问,因为偶尔我会从程序员那里获得项目的帮助,如果他从他的计算机登录我的帐户并使用我的配置打开vim,那么配色方案通常非常苛刻,因为他没有使用一个支持256色的终端。设置我的.vimrc文件会更容易,如果它检测到gui(例如,我使用的是iTerm而不是Terminal.app),它会加载我更喜欢的colorscheme吗?
感谢您的任何建议!
答案 0 :(得分:10)
以下是使用MacVim编辑服务器上文件的方法,但它要求您先在本地计算机上启动MacVim。
首先确保安装了netrw
。检查:help netrw
以确认确实存在。
然后在启动MacVim之后,您可以键入以下内容:
:e scp://username@yourserverdomain.com/.bash_profile
您应该在MacVim vim会话中看到该文件已打开。编辑并保存。
设置ssh密钥以自动验证您进入服务器将有所帮助。